Who Is Jon Gruden? A Comprehensive Biography

Jon David Gruden, born on August 17, 1963, in Sandusky, Ohio, is a celebrated figure in American football. Known for his high-energy coaching style, Gruden became the youngest coach to win Super Bowl XXXVII at age 39 with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ers. His career spans decades, including roles with the Oakland/Las Vegas Raiders, Tampa Bay Buccaneers, and as an ESPN analyst. Gruden’s passion for football stems from his father, Jim Gruden, a former coach, and his brother, Jay Gruden, a former NFL coach. His early exposure to the sport shaped his relentless work ethic. A lesser-known fact: Gruden’s nickname “Chucky” comes from his fiery demeanor, likened to the horror movie character.
